So far, in terms of sound production, we’ve explored triggering synths
and recorded sounds via the fns play, synth and sample. These have
then generated audio which has played through our stereo speaker
system. However, many computers also have the ability to input sound,
perhaps through a microphone, in addition to the ability to send sound
out to more than two speakers. Often, this capability is made possible
through the use of an external sound card - these are available for all
platforms. In this section of the tutorial we’ll take a look at how we
can take advantage of these external sound cards and effortlessly work
with multiple channels of audio in and out of Sonic Pi.
